if you’re considering getting an Elvis Presley-inspired tattoo, there are various creative and meaningful ideas you can explore. Elvis had a significant impact on music and pop culture, so there are plenty of iconic symbols, lyrics, and imagery associated with him that could serve as inspiration for your tattoo. Here are some Elvis Presley tattoo ideas to consider:

  • Portrait Tattoo: A realistic or stylized portrait of Elvis captures his iconic look and serves as a tribute to his influence on music and entertainment.
  • Microphone and Guitar: Depicting a microphone and guitar symbolizes Elvis’ stage presence and musical talents.
  • Signature: Getting Elvis’ signature tattooed is a simple and elegant way to pay homage to the King of Rock and Roll.
  • 1950s Era: Choose imagery from Elvis’ early career, like a jukebox, vinyl record, or retro microphone, to represent his rise to fame.
  • Heartbreak Hotel Neon Sign: Incorporate the neon sign from “Heartbreak Hotel,” one of his most famous songs, as a nod to his discography.
  • Tupelo Birthplace: A tattoo of his birthplace in Tupelo, Mississippi, can symbolize his roots and beginnings.
  • Elvis Silhouette: Capture his iconic silhouette with his signature hairstyle and a guitar.
  • Lyrics: Consider getting meaningful lyrics from one of his songs inked, such as lines from “Can’t Help Falling in Love.”
  • Aloha from Hawaii: The famous Aloha jumpsuit and a Hawaiian flower motif can represent his legendary concert and global impact.
  • Dance Moves: Incorporate his signature hip-shaking dance moves as a dynamic and vibrant tattoo design.
  • Elvis’ Sunglasses: Elvis’ stylish sunglasses are an instantly recognizable symbol that represents his cool and charismatic persona.
  • King of Rock and Roll Crown: Highlight his title with a crown tattoo to celebrate his status as the King of Rock and Roll.
  • Gospel Cross: A cross intertwined with musical notes and gospel imagery can represent his connection to gospel music.
  • Graceland Gate: The Graceland mansion’s distinctive gates could serve as a meaningful symbol of his home and legacy.
  • Pink Cadillac: Elvis’ pink Cadillac is an iconic representation of his flamboyant style and larger-than-life personality.
  • Microphone Stand: A microphone stand with Elvis’ initials or his famous “TCB” motto can capture his live performance energy.
  • Elvis and Priscilla: A tattoo depicting Elvis and his wife Priscilla can commemorate their relationship and love story.
  • Hound Dog: Incorporate the image of a hound dog as a playful reference to his hit song “Hound Dog.”
  • Music Notes: Combine Elvis-themed imagery with musical notes or sheet music to emphasize his impact on the music industry.
  • Memphis Skyline: Include the Memphis skyline as a backdrop to reference his connection to the city and its music scene.
